Assessing Math Concepts: Number Arrangements helps teachers understand how children see and organize numbers. This resource focuses on a student's ability to recognize number patterns, understand visual groupings, and make sense of numbers arranged in structured and unstructured formats.


Number Arrangements gives teachers clear assessment tasks that reveal how students interpret quantities without counting each object. By observing how children respond to number patterns, teachers gain insights into early numeracy development and can adjust instruction to support flexible thinking. The book includes background information for teachers, step by step guidance for assessments, observation tips, and reproducible black line masters for classroom use.


This resource supports foundational ideas that lead to strong number sense and fluency. It is ideal for classroom instruction, intervention, and progress monitoring across early elementary grades.
